Speaker Presentation

Richard E. Goldstein, MD, PhD, MHCM, FACS, Vice Dean for Clinical Affairs, University of Louisville School of Medicine will present on "Accountable Care Organizations."
  
Dr. Richard Goldstein is Vice Dean for Clinical Affairs at the University of Louisville School of Medicine, where he is on the faculty as Professor of Surgery and Professor of Pharmacology and Toxicology, also holding the vonRoenn Family Chair in Surgical Endocrinology. His principal research interests are surgical endocrinology and surgical oncology. Dr. Goldstein maintains his medical practice with University Surgical Associates, PSC, with hospital privileges at University of Louisville Hospital, Norton Hospital, and Jewish Hospital, Louisville, Kentucky. He is certified by the National Board of Medical Examiners, the American Board of Surgery, and as a Provider of Advanced Trauma Support. He received his M.D. from Thomas Jefferson University,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, and his Ph.D. in Molecular Physiology and Biophysics from Vanderbilt University, Nashville, Tennessee. Dr. Goldstein served his residency at Vanderbilt University Hospital in Surgery and ultimately as Chief Resident.
